HBF Health Limited is seeking a Senior Manager Operational Resilience to join our Risk function as a Line 2 professional. You will provide expert oversight across operational, technology and cyber resilience, influencing how risks are identified, managed and monitored.
In this senior, individual contributor role, you will work with Control Assurance, uplift resilience capability, and support APRA standards CPS 220, CPS 230 and CPS 234, delivering evidence‑based insights to senior leaders.
At HBF, we're focused on building the resilience needed to continue supporting our members through disruption. As the Senior Manager Operational Resilience, you'll join our specialist Risk function as a senior Line 2 professional, providing oversight across operational resilience, technology resilience and cyber resilience risk. This is a senior individual contributor role where you'll provide expert advice and constructive challenge, influencing how resilience risks are identified, managed and monitored.
Working closely with the Control Assurance function, you'll contribute specialist input into resilience, technology and cyber control assurance activities while helping uplift resilience capability across HBF. You'll support compliance with APRA standards including CPS 220, CPS 230 and CPS 234, contribute to resilience maturity assessments and transformation initiatives, and provide clear, evidence‑based insights to senior leaders and governance forums.
Most importantly, you'll help strengthen HBF's ability to withstand, respond to and recover from disruption.
Key responsibilities include Lead independent Line 2 oversight of operational resilience frameworks and practices aligned to CPS 220, CPS 230 and CPS 234. Assess the resilience of critical operations, services, technology assets and third‑party dependencies. Review business continuity, disaster recovery, crisis management and resilience testing activities. Support APRA engagements, self‑assessments, prudential submissions and remediation activities. Monitor disruption events and incident trends, challenging remediation actions and lessons learned. Deliver evidence‑based reporting and insights to senior leadership. Drive continuous improvement in resilience capability, preparedness, response and recovery arrangements.
